WebAug 15, 2015 · Meaning of bruit in English bruit verb [ T ] formal us / bruːt / uk / bruːt / to tell everyone a piece of news: It's been bruited about/ abroad /around that he's going to leave … WebBruit is traditionally pronounced broot, rhyming with fruit, although the etymologically accurate pronunciation bru´e or bru-e´ is common in North American medical parlance. [5] In addition, while bruit and murmur are technically synonymous, the term bruit is generally reserved for arterial sounds in North America. [4] References [ edit]
